#15903: Changeset 16053 breaks a few views tests
------------------------+---------------------------------------------
     Reporter:  jezdez  |                    Owner:  nobody
         Type:  Bug     |                   Status:  new
    Milestone:          |                Component:  Testing framework
      Version:  1.3     |                 Severity:  Release blocker
     Keywords:          |             Triage Stage:  Accepted
    Has patch:  0       |      Needs documentation:  0
  Needs tests:  0       |  Patch needs improvement:  0
Easy pickings:  0       |
------------------------+---------------------------------------------
 Traceback:

 {{{
 (django-dev)~/Code/git/django/tests [git:master] $ python runtests.py
 --settings=test_sqlite views
 Creating test database for alias 'default'...
 Creating test database for alias 'other'...
 
..........EEE..........................................................................
 ======================================================================
 ERROR: test_template_exceptions
 (regressiontests.views.tests.debug.DebugViewTests)
 ----------------------------------------------------------------------
 Traceback (most recent call last):
   File
 "/Users/jezdez/Code/git/django/tests/regressiontests/views/tests/debug.py",
 line 48, in test_template_exceptions
     self.client.get(reverse('template_exception', args=(n,)))
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 391, in reverse
     *args, **kwargs)))
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 312, in reverse
     possibilities = self.reverse_dict.getlist(lookup_view)
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 229, in _get_reverse_dict
     self._populate()
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 208, in _populate
     for name in pattern.reverse_dict:
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 229, in _get_reverse_dict
     self._populate()
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 197, in _populate
     for pattern in reversed(self.url_patterns):
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 279, in _get_url_patterns
     patterns = getattr(self.urlconf_module, "urlpatterns",
 self.urlconf_module)
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 274, in _get_urlconf_module
     self._urlconf_module = import_module(self.urlconf_name)
   File "/Users/jezdez/Code/git/django/django/utils/importlib.py", line 35,
 in import_module
     __import__(name)
   File
 "/Users/jezdez/Code/git/django/tests/regressiontests/admin_views/urls.py",
 line 4, in <module>
     import customadmin
   File
 
"/Users/jezdez/Code/git/django/tests/regressiontests/admin_views/customadmin.py",
 line 8, in <module>
     import models, forms
   File
 "/Users/jezdez/Code/git/django/tests/regressiontests/admin_views/models.py",
 line 860, in <module>
     admin.site.register(ChapterXtra1, ChapterXtra1Admin)
   File "/Users/jezdez/Code/git/django/django/contrib/admin/sites.py", line
 98, in register
     validate(admin_class, model)
   File "/Users/jezdez/Code/git/django/django/contrib/admin/validation.py",
 line 63, in validate
     cls.__name__, idx, fpath
 ImproperlyConfigured: 'ChapterXtra1Admin.list_filter[4]' refers to
 'chap__book__promo' which does not refer to a Field.

 ======================================================================
 ERROR: test_template_loader_postmortem
 (regressiontests.views.tests.debug.DebugViewTests)
 ----------------------------------------------------------------------
 Traceback (most recent call last):
   File
 "/Users/jezdez/Code/git/django/tests/regressiontests/views/tests/debug.py",
 line 56, in test_template_loader_postmortem
     response = self.client.get(reverse('raises_template_does_not_exist'))
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 391, in reverse
     *args, **kwargs)))
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 312, in reverse
     possibilities = self.reverse_dict.getlist(lookup_view)
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 229, in _get_reverse_dict
     self._populate()
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 208, in _populate
     for name in pattern.reverse_dict:
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 229, in _get_reverse_dict
     self._populate()
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 197, in _populate
     for pattern in reversed(self.url_patterns):
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 279, in _get_url_patterns
     patterns = getattr(self.urlconf_module, "urlpatterns",
 self.urlconf_module)
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 274, in _get_urlconf_module
     self._urlconf_module = import_module(self.urlconf_name)
   File "/Users/jezdez/Code/git/django/django/utils/importlib.py", line 35,
 in import_module
     __import__(name)
   File
 "/Users/jezdez/Code/git/django/tests/regressiontests/admin_views/urls.py",
 line 4, in <module>
     import customadmin
   File
 
"/Users/jezdez/Code/git/django/tests/regressiontests/admin_views/customadmin.py",
 line 8, in <module>
     import models, forms
   File
 "/Users/jezdez/Code/git/django/tests/regressiontests/admin_views/models.py",
 line 806, in <module>
     admin.site.register(Article, ArticleAdmin)
   File "/Users/jezdez/Code/git/django/django/contrib/admin/sites.py", line
 86, in register
     raise AlreadyRegistered('The model %s is already registered' %
 model.__name__)
 AlreadyRegistered: The model Article is already registered

 ======================================================================
 ERROR: test_view_exceptions
 (regressiontests.views.tests.debug.DebugViewTests)
 ----------------------------------------------------------------------
 Traceback (most recent call last):
   File
 "/Users/jezdez/Code/git/django/tests/regressiontests/views/tests/debug.py",
 line 43, in test_view_exceptions
     reverse('view_exception', args=(n,)))
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 391, in reverse
     *args, **kwargs)))
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 312, in reverse
     possibilities = self.reverse_dict.getlist(lookup_view)
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 229, in _get_reverse_dict
     self._populate()
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 208, in _populate
     for name in pattern.reverse_dict:
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 229, in _get_reverse_dict
     self._populate()
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 197, in _populate
     for pattern in reversed(self.url_patterns):
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 279, in _get_url_patterns
     patterns = getattr(self.urlconf_module, "urlpatterns",
 self.urlconf_module)
   File "/Users/jezdez/Code/git/django/django/core/urlresolvers.py", line
 274, in _get_urlconf_module
     self._urlconf_module = import_module(self.urlconf_name)
   File "/Users/jezdez/Code/git/django/django/utils/importlib.py", line 35,
 in import_module
     __import__(name)
   File
 "/Users/jezdez/Code/git/django/tests/regressiontests/admin_views/urls.py",
 line 4, in <module>
     import customadmin
   File
 
"/Users/jezdez/Code/git/django/tests/regressiontests/admin_views/customadmin.py",
 line 8, in <module>
     import models, forms
   File
 "/Users/jezdez/Code/git/django/tests/regressiontests/admin_views/models.py",
 line 806, in <module>
     admin.site.register(Article, ArticleAdmin)
   File "/Users/jezdez/Code/git/django/django/contrib/admin/sites.py", line
 86, in register
     raise AlreadyRegistered('The model %s is already registered' %
 model.__name__)
 AlreadyRegistered: The model Article is already registered

 ----------------------------------------------------------------------
 Ran 87 tests in 2.260s

 FAILED (errors=3)
 Destroying test database for alias 'default'...
 Destroying test database for alias 'other'...
 (django-dev)~/Code/git/django/tests [git:master] $
 }}}

-- 
Ticket URL: <http://code.djangoproject.com/ticket/15903>
Django <http://code.djangoproject.com/>
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To post to this group, send email to django-updates@googlegroups.com.
To unsubscribe from this group, send email to 
django-updates+unsubscr...@googlegroups.com.
For more options, visit this group at 
http://groups.google.com/group/django-updates?hl=en.

Reply via email to